There is no way for the MJ customer to learn directly who made this anonymous call. When a caller requests anonymity by dialing the *67 code in front of the number it instructs the telephone network to withhold the calling number from the destination party. YMAX, MJ's telephone provider, does receive this information in the SS7 incoming call packet, but they will not disclose it to the MJ user. This is how it is possible to use *69 to call an anonymous party back without having known that party's phone number.

You would be entitled to know the anonymous party's phone number if you were paying for the incoming call. Since MJ does not support collect calls and does not offer toll free numbers, MJ would never disclose such a phone number to you.

If you are in the mood for a challenge you can try to get your local police to investigate your harassing phone calls. You supply the police with your MJ phone number and the exact time and date of each call (in Eastern Standard Time, regardless of what time zone you live in or whether Daylight Savings Time is in effect, since that is the only time stamp MJ uses). The police can then demand the disclosure of the calling party's information for use in their case. MJ Customer Service being what it is, the detectives will probably get more cooperation out of MJ "with a smile and a subpoena than with a smile alone."
